MMOROSA

MMOROSA
This I write with
invisible tears. . .
If I should one day say
How unkempt is your beard
It would be heard
By the whole world

Brother, if I should talk
About how big is your head
Again every ear will hear

If I ever talked about
How poor is your sight
Who on earth wouldn't hear?

What if I said
You wear the beard
Of  the wise men of old-
And your head
Is swollen with wisdom
How far would it spread?

Brother, what if I shouted
Your eyes are stars
That can light up a world
Trapped in darkness-
Who would hear it?
My brother, who?
©Sarpong Kumankoma
